George G. Netto
October 1, 1928 - March 29, 2017
Santa Clara
George moved back to Santa Clara where he died peacefully in the home where he and his wife raised three children. He was an outgoing and fun loving man with big, strong hands and an even larger heart. He loved all things outdoors; camping, boating, fishing, auto racing as well as the 49ers and the SF Giants. His pride and joy was his 1965 Mustang convertible and his family!
Born in Santa Clara then raised on an apple orchard in Aromas, CA, one of six children of John and Rose Netto. Married his high school sweetheart, Jewel Page, then enlisted in the Navy. Upon discharge, he joined the Teamster's Union and worked for Hadley Auto Transport as an auto transport driver for 42 years. He also served on Teamster's Local 287 Executive Board as VP and Trustee.
Predeceased by daughter, Marilyn Maggetti and wife Jewel Netto, George is survived by his beloved sons - John (Anne) Netto, George (Charlotte) Netto, sisters - Evelyn Balla and Madeline Brickwedel as well as 6 grandchildren and 9 great-grandchildren.
